Best universities for biochemistry?

Hello everyone! I'm a junior and really passionate about biochemistry. I'm starting to think about college applications and want to make a list of top universities for biochemistry programs. Can you guys give me any recommendations? Grateful for any help!

Hello! It's fantastic that you're passionate about biochemistry and looking into colleges that can support your interests. I'm happy to help you create a list of top universities with strong biochemistry programs. Keep in mind that this list is by no means exhaustive, but it's a great starting point:

1. Massachusetts Institute of Technology (MIT)

2. Harvard University

3. Stanford University

4. California Institute of Technology (Caltech)

5. Yale University

6. Princeton University

7. Johns Hopkins University

8. University of California, Berkeley

9. University of California, Los Angeles (UCLA)

10. University of Pennsylvania (UPenn)

These universities often have excellent research facilities, opportunities to work with leading faculty in the field, and strong academic programs in biochemistry. Don't forget to look into each university's specific biochemistry department, research options, and course offerings to ensure it aligns with your personal interests and goals.

Additionally, when making your college list, consider factors beyond just the biochemistry program. These may include campus size, location, extracurricular opportunities, financial aid, and campus culture.

Lastly, while it's great to apply to top schools for biochemistry, remember to balance your college list with a mix of reach, match, and safety schools. This will improve your chances of having options when decisions are released.
